Vancouver Whitecaps play host to LAFC in game two of their MLS Cup playoffs best-of-three series in round one, with the Black and Gold up 1-0 in the series.
A frantic game one saw LAFC go in front twice in the first half only to be pegged back twice by Vancouver, going into the break all knotted up at 2-2. The reigning MLS Cup champions showed their quality in the second 45, though, as Golden Boot winner Denis Bouanga and full-back Ryan Hollingshead ended the night with braces, while center-back Jesus Murillo rounding off the scoring to make it 5-2 at BMO Stadium.
The Whitecaps proved they could keep up with LAFC in the first half, but faltered in the second half due to their lack of concentration on the defensive end. Will Vancouver snatch game two to tie the series up, or will LAFC sweep their Western Conference foes?

Whitecaps boss Vanni Sartini will be without backup goalkeeper Thomas Hasal and full-back Russell Teibert, with the former dealing with a knee problem and the latter recovering from a hip injury. Both players should be back in the mix later this month if Vancouver are still in the postseason.
Hasal and Teibert haven’t featured too much for Vancouver in 2023, but Sartini still has Isaac Boehmer and Luis Martins in his squad to help supply depth.
Vancouver Whitecaps predicted lineup vs LAFC ( 3-1-4-1 ): Takaoka; Brown, Veselinovic, Blackmon; Berhalter; Laryea, Schopf, Vite, Adekugbe; White, Gauld.
Unlike Sartini, LAFC boss Steve Cherundolo has no injury concerns within his squad ahead of the game two contest.
LAFC predicted lineup vs Vancouver Whitecaps ( 4-3-3 ): Crepeau; Hollingshead, Murillo, Chiellini, Palacios; Tillman, Sanchez, Bogusz; Olivera, Vela, Bouanga.
